Supporting CCTV and IP
surveillance, KP-104 is a special keyboard / multiplexer for
SOHO and simple users.
The KP-104 has 4 inputs to adapt 4 cameras -- all inputs are the
RJ-45 jacks. Cameras are to be connected to and powered by
KP-104 via Cat-5 cables, the most simple way for
camera-controller wiring.
This device has joystick and preset buttons for AD camera
control. RS-485 signal for PT control is provided to each RJ-45
port, so when an AD camera is hooked to the keyboard, user may
do pan, tilt, preset set up and call to the AD camera. To
connect regular / fixed camera, an UTP device is requried (see
VT-100M and VT-200).
The KP-104 also has one RS-232 port for communicating with PC
for IP surveillance (see Beacon system).
It has two parallel video outputs with options of single /
sequential mode. Extra 4 video loop-out are available on back
panel to forward video signals to Quad or DVR. |
